Germany shares lower at close of trade; DAX down 1.36%

Investing.com – Germany equities were lower at the close on Monday, as losses in the Software , Technology and Retail sectors propelled shares lower.
At the close in Frankfurt, the DAX lost 1.36% to hit a new 6-month low, while the MDAX index fell 1.64%, and the TecDAX index lost 3.61%.
The biggest gainers of the session on the DAX were Vonovia SE (DE: VNAn ), which rose 0.41% or 0.16 points to trade at 39.64 at the close. Thyssenkrupp AG O.N. (DE: TKAG ) added 0.34% or 0.070 points to end at 20.670 and Covestro AG (DE: 1COV ) was up 0.24% or 0.160 points to 66.760 in late trade.
Biggest losers included Commerzbank AG O.N. (DE: CBKG ), which lost 4.55% or 0.407 points to trade at 8.542 in late trade. RWE AG ST O.N. (DE: RWEG ) declined 3.00% or 0.560 points to end at 18.130 and Infineon Technologies AG NA O.N. (DE: IFXGn ) shed 2.74% or 0.540 points to 19.200.
The top performers on the MDAX were Metro Wholesale & Food Specialist AG (DE: B4B ) which rose 1.07% to 13.6750, Deutsche Wohnen AG (DE: DWNG ) which was up 1.03% to settle at 40.090 and Grand City Properties SA (DE: GYC ) which gained 0.75% to close at 21.42.
The worst performers were Delivery Hero AG (DE: DHER ) which was down 5.84% to 37.40 in late trade, Jungheinrich AG O.N.VZO (DE: JUNG_p ) which lost 4.75% to settle at 29.700 and CTS Eventim AG (DE: EVDG ) which was down 4.22% to 35.820 at the close.
The top performers on the TecDAX were RIB Software AG Na (DE: RIB ) which fell 0.86% to 16.150, Qiagen NV (DE: QIA ) which was down 1.30% to settle at 31.160 and Freenet AG NA (DE: FNTGn ) which lost 1.38% to close at 19.725.
The worst performers were Wirecard AG (DE: WDIG ) which was down 11.89% to 166.525 in late trade, SLM Solutions Group AG (DE: AM3D ) which lost 8.87% to settle at 17.06 and Medigene NA O.N. (DE: MDG1k ) which was down 8.22% to 10.830 at the close.
Declining stocks outnumbered rising ones by 544 to 176 and 59 ended unchanged on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ange.
The DAX volatility index , which measures the implied volatility of DAX options, was unchanged 0.00% to 16.85.
In commodities trading, Gold Futures for December delivery was down 1.29% or 15.50 to $1190.10 a troy ounce. Meanwhile, Crude oil for delivery in November fell 0.67% or 0.50 to hit $73.84 a barrel, while the December Brent oil contract fell 0.95% or 0.80 to trade at $83.36 a barrel.
EUR/USD was down 0.44% to 1.1473, while EUR/GBP rose 0.08% to 0.8786.
The US Dollar Index Futures was up 0.25% at 95.55.
